/* -------------------------------------------------------------------
³ôŽ®¡¦ÅêÁéÅàËèFÍÍ¡¦(¥¢¥Ë¥å¥¢¥ë¥ì¥Ý¡¼¥È)
------------------------------------------------------------------- */

.annualBox {
	margin: 20px 20px 0px 20px;
	padding: 0px 0px 20px 0px;
}

.annualBox .toptxt {
	margin: 0px 0px 20px 0px;
	padding: 3px 2px 2px 2px;
	font-family: "£Í£Ó £Ð¥´¥·¥Ã¥¯", Osaka, "¥Ò¥é¥®¥Î³Ñ¥´ Pro W3", sans-serif;
	font-size: 12px;
	border: 1px solid #D2D2D2;
	text-align: center;
	width: 150px;
}

.annualBox .toptxt img {
	margin: 0px 5px 0px 0px;
}

.annualBox .year {
    margin: 0px 5px 2px 0px;
	padding: 0px 0px 2px 0px;
    font-size: 14px;
}

.annualBox p {
	margin: 0px 0px 20px 0px;
}

.annualBox ul {
	margin: 0px 0px 18px 0px;
}

.annualBox ul li {
	padding: 0px 0px 0px 0em;
}

.annualBox ul.ir {
	margin: 10px 0px 18px 0px;
}

.annualBox ul.ir li {
	padding: 0px 0px 8px 0em;
}

.annualBox ul.ir li img {
	padding: 0px 0px 0px 0em;
	margin: 0px 10px 0px 0px;
}

.annualBoxIndex {
	margin: 0px 0px 0px 5px;
	padding: 0px 0px 0px 0px;
	width: 360px;
	float: left;
}

.annualBoxIndex p {
	margin: 0px 0px 0px 0px;
}

.annualBoxIndex ul {
	margin: 0px 0px 18px 0px;
}

.annualBoxIndex ul li {
	padding: 0px 0px 0px 0em;
}

.annualBoxIndex ul.ir {
	margin: 10px 10px 18px 0px;
	float: left;
}

.annualBoxIndex ul.ir li {
	padding: 0px 0px 10px 15px;
	text-indent: -10px;
	font-family: "£Í£Ó £Ð¥´¥·¥Ã¥¯", Osaka, "¥Ò¥é¥®¥Î³Ñ¥´ Pro W3", sans-serif;
	font-size: 100%;
	line-height: 140%;
}

.annualBoxIndex ul.ir li img {
	padding: 0px 0px 0px 0em;
	margin: 0px 5px 0px -5px;
}

.annualBoxIndex_en {
	margin: 0px 0px 0px 5px;
	padding: 0px 0px 0px 0px;
	width: 600px;
	float: left;
}

.annualBoxIndex_en p {
	margin: 0px 0px 0px 0px;
}

.annualBoxIndex_en ul {
	margin: 0px 0px 18px 0px;
}

.annualBoxIndex_en ul li {
	padding: 0px 0px 0px 0em;
}

.annualBoxIndex_en ul.ir {
	margin: 10px 10px 18px 0px;
	float: left;
}

.annualBoxIndex_en ul.ir li {
	padding: 0px 0px 10px 15px;
	text-indent: -10px;
	font-family: "£Í£Ó £Ð¥´¥·¥Ã¥¯", Osaka, "¥Ò¥é¥®¥Î³Ñ¥´ Pro W3", sans-serif;
	font-size: 100%;
	line-height: 140%;
}

.annualBoxIndex_en ul.ir li img {
	padding: 0px 0px 0px 0em;
	margin: 0px 5px 0px -5px;
}

/************ir¥¢¥Ë¥å¥¢¥ë¥ì¥Ý¡¼¥È¡Ê200809Ä´À°¡Ë**************/
.ir_subject_top {
	font-weight:bold;
}

.ir_subject_second {
	margin-left:1em;
}

